According to the Power Rankings here at Odds Shark it's the No. 73-rated UAB Blazers and the No. 35-rated LA Tech Bulldogs in this matchup.

Statistical Matchup

Offensively, the game matches up the UAB Blazers No. 35-ranked offense (35.5 PPG) against a LA Tech Bulldogs defense that ranks No. 75 at 27.2 PPG. The UAB Blazers passing attack has averaged 189.75 yards per game, less than the LA Tech Bulldogs give up through the air (228.8 YPG on average).

In comparing defenses, the LA Tech Bulldogs own the league's No. 59-rated front 7 in terms of stopping the run, allowing 147 yards per game when on the road. UAB, on the other hand, rates No. 43 this week in generating rushing yards at home.

Recent Outings Betting Recap

In their last game, LA Tech's aerial attack generated 317 yards and the Bulldogs came away with a 34-16 victory over South Alabama at Joe Aillet Stadium.

In UAB's last outing, A.J. Erdely threw for 321 yards in a losing cause against the Mean Green, 46-43 at Apogee Stadium.
